What is هبوط الرحلة?
In this glossary, هبوط الرحلة refers to: A descent at a controlled rate while maintaining cruise speed.
How is هبوط الرحلة used in aviation?
In aviation communication, this term appears in contexts such as: "طيار، حافظ على هبوط الرحلة إلى مستوى الطيران اثنين أربعة صفر."
